On the Efficient Implementation of Pairing-Based Protocols
Source: Dublin City University
The advent of Pairing-based protocols has had a major impact on the applicability of cryptography to the solution of more complex real-world problems. However, there has always been a question mark over the performance of such protocols. In response much work has been done to optimize pairing implementation, and now it is generally accepted that being pairing-based does not preclude a protocol from consideration as a practical proposition. However, although a lot of effort has gone into the optimization of the stand-alone pairing, in many protocols the pairing calculation appears in a particular context within which further optimizations may be possible.
